Nine men have appeared in court charged with a total of 41 historical sexual offences, relating to eight victims who were children at the time.
Appearing at Newport Magistrates' Court, the defendants were told most charges were so serious that the cases would be transferred to Crown court.
They will appear at Cardiff Crown Court on 21 August.
Operation Oak has been described by the force as a "complex and long-running investigation into group-based child sexual exploitation in south Wales".
No pleas were entered during the short hearings at Newport Magistrates' Court on Friday.
